Why to visit Panna Meena Ka Kund

On the outskirts of the city, there is a hidden architectural gem called Panna Meena ka Kund. It is a magnificent stepwell that displays the splendor of the buildings that a man constructed a few centuries ago.

It is a square-shaped stepwell with stairs on each of its four sides and a chamber on the Kund's northern side. The stepwell has been maintained by the municipal body for the past twenty years, making this amazing Kund well worth a visit.

History of Panna Meena Ka Kund: 

  • The majority of people hold the view that this illustrious and ancient Kund was constructed in order to provide enough water for the Amerian population.
  • Later, the nearby temples used the Kund's water for their local purpose. 
  • Rajasthani traditional women come here as well to fill the earthen pots used for both domestic chores and drinking water.

Highlights of the Panna Meena Ka Kund:

  • The staircase's unusually symmetrical appearance is Panna Meena ka Kund's greatest draw.
  • You can easily go up and down a few flights of steps to get to any of the stairs from wherever.
  • There is plenty of room in these stairwells for guests to sit down, converse, have some alone time, and engage in photo shoots.
  • Elderly people sit along the numerous staircases, while couples can enjoy some quality time together by hanging their legs off the side of the stairwells.
  • Young local guys competing among themselves by leaping into the pool from the edge of the Kund above can be seen during the summer and monsoon seasons.

How to reach Panna Meena Ka Kund?

It is not difficult to get to the Panna Meena ka Kund because it is close to all of Jaipur's main stops. About 21 kilometres separate the Panna Meena ka Kund from the Jaipur International Airport. 11 kilometres separate the Panna Meena ka Kund from the Jaipur railway station. The distance between the Sindhi Camp bus stop and the Panna Meena ka Kund is about 12 kilometers.
